Question:
Replacement for Atwood 75721. Does this new motor come with directions for removing old motor? Can the motor be replaced with the trailer resting on the Jacks or does it need to be stabilized differently? Thanks
asked by: Joy J
Expert Reply:
Those are a couple of good questions, and to start, I just want to confirm the correct replacement for your Atwood 75721 motor is the Replacement Motor # LG-142178. Now, in regards to removing the motor, it is extremely simple as literally all you have to do is unscrew your old motor and screw in the new one with the included hardware. To reconnect your wiring you just have to use Heat Shrink Butt Connectors # DW05745-5.
Written instructions are not included with the new motor, but I have added a link to a video that shows you exactly how to do it which I recommend checking out; the motor removal and re-install happens just after the 3:00 mark. To answer your other question, you can replace the motor with the trailer resting on your landing gear jacks so you won't need to stabilize it differently.
